嗨,各位小伙伴們!今天,我這個資深網(wǎng)站小編又要來和大家聊聊建站啦。隨著互聯(lián)網(wǎng)的蓬勃發(fā)展,建站已經(jīng)成為很多小伙伴的剛需,但是如何選擇一個適合自己的主機(jī)系統(tǒng)卻讓不少小伙伴頭疼不已。今天,我就來給大家揭秘一下 Ubuntu 在建站領(lǐng)域的強(qiáng)大魅力,讓你輕松開啟建站之旅!
一、Ubuntu 是什么? 它為什么適合建站?
Ubuntu 是一款基于 Debian 的 Linux 發(fā)行版,以其易用性、穩(wěn)定性和社區(qū)支持而聞名。對于建站新手來說,Ubuntu 提供了以下優(yōu)勢:
1. 易于安裝和配置:Ubuntu 以其安裝和配置的簡便性著稱,無論你是第一次接觸操作系統(tǒng)還是經(jīng)驗(yàn)豐富的 Linux 用戶,都能輕松上手。
2. 穩(wěn)定可靠:Ubuntu 經(jīng)過嚴(yán)格測試,以確保其穩(wěn)定可靠。當(dāng)你需要一個不會頻繁崩潰或出現(xiàn)問題的操作系統(tǒng)時,Ubuntu 就是一個理想的選擇。
3. 強(qiáng)大的社區(qū)支持:Ubuntu 擁有一個龐大的在線社區(qū),隨時可以提供幫助和支持。無論你遇到什么總能找到有人愿意伸出援手。
二、與其他主機(jī)系統(tǒng)相比,Ubuntu 的優(yōu)勢在哪?
在建站領(lǐng)域,Ubuntu 與其他主機(jī)系統(tǒng)如 Windows 和 CentOS 相比,優(yōu)勢顯而易見:
| 主機(jī)系統(tǒng) | 優(yōu)勢 | 劣勢 |
|---|---|---|
| Ubuntu | 易于安裝和配置、穩(wěn)定可靠、強(qiáng)大的社區(qū)支持 | 可用軟件較少、硬件兼容性可能存在問題 |
| Windows | 廣泛的軟件支持、用戶友好界面 | 價格昂貴、安全性和穩(wěn)定性較差 |
| CentOS | 穩(wěn)定性高、安全性好 | 使用門檻較高、軟件支持有限 |
三、Ubuntu 搭建網(wǎng)站的最佳選擇:Apache?Nginx?還是
在 Ubuntu 上搭建網(wǎng)站,有 Apache、Nginx 和其他幾個備選方案可供選擇。以下是每個選項(xiàng)的優(yōu)缺點(diǎn):
| Web 服務(wù)器 | 優(yōu)勢 | 劣勢 |
|---|---|---|
| Apache | 功能豐富、配置靈活、社區(qū)支持廣泛 | 資源占用較高、性能可能較差 |
| Nginx | 性能優(yōu)化、內(nèi)存占用低、并發(fā)處理能力強(qiáng) | 功能相對較弱、配置復(fù)雜性較高 |
| 其他 (如 Caddy、Lighttpd) | 輕量級、易于配置 | 功能有限、社區(qū)支持較弱 |
對于大多數(shù)建站新手來說,Apache 是一個不錯的選擇。它功能全面、配置靈活,并且擁有龐大的社區(qū)支持。
四、如何在 Ubuntu 上安裝和配置 Apache?
安裝和配置 Apache 在 Ubuntu 上非常簡單:
1. 安裝 Apache:在終端中輸入以下命令:
sudo apt update
sudo apt install apache2 -y
2. 檢查 Apache 狀態(tài):使用以下命令檢查 Apache 是否正在運(yùn)行:
systemctl status apache2
3. 配置 Apache:編輯 Apache 配置文件 /etc/apache2/apache2.conf,調(diào)整以下設(shè)置:
1. 文檔根目錄 (通常為 /var/www/html)
2. 端口號 (通常為 80)
4. 重啟 Apache:使用以下命令重啟 Apache,使更改生效:
sudo systemctl restart apache2
五、如何在 Ubuntu 上安裝和配置 WordPress?
WordPress 是世界上最流行的建站平臺。在 Ubuntu 上安裝和配置 WordPress 也非常簡單:
1. 安裝 LAMP 堆棧:LAMP 堆棧是 Apache、MySQL 和 PHP 的組合,為 WordPress 運(yùn)行提供必要的環(huán)境。在終端中輸入以下命令:
sudo apt update
sudo apt install lamp-server^ -y
2. 創(chuàng)建數(shù)據(jù)庫:使用以下命令創(chuàng)建 WordPress 數(shù)據(jù)庫:
mysql -u root -p
CREATE DATABASE wordpress;
GRANT ALL PRIVILEGES ON wordpress. TO 'wordpressuser'@'localhost' IDENTIFIED BY 'password';
FLUSH PRIVILEGES;
exit
3. 下載 WordPress:從 WordPress 官方網(wǎng)站 (https://wordpress.org/) 下載最新的 WordPress 版本。
4. 解壓縮 WordPress:解壓縮下載的 WordPress 文件到 /var/www/html 目錄:
tar -xzvf wordpress-latest.tar.gz -C /var/www/html
5. 配置 WordPress:編輯 /var/www/html/wordpress/wp-config.php 文件,調(diào)整以下設(shè)置:
1. 數(shù)據(jù)庫名稱
2. 數(shù)據(jù)庫用戶名
3. 數(shù)據(jù)庫密碼
4. 表前綴
6. 安裝 WordPress:訪問 http://localhost/wordpress 并按照說明完成 WordPress 安裝。
小伙伴們,看完這篇文章后,你們對 Ubuntu 的建站優(yōu)勢有了更深入的了解了嗎?如果你們有什么建站心得體會或者想了解的建站歡迎在評論區(qū)留言,讓我們一起交流探索!